Here are some of the top roles to explore: - HR **Data Analyst**: With the rise of data-driven decision-making, HR Data Analysts are increasingly in demand. They help organizations make informed decisions on talent management, employee engagement, and performance improvement. - **AI Ethics Manager**: This role ensures that AI technologies are developed and implemented ethically in HR processes. They address potential biases, privacy concerns, and transparency issues in AI systems. - **HR Tech Project Manager**: HR Tech Project Managers lead the development, implementation, and maintenance of HR technology systems. They collaborate with various stakeholders, manage resources, and ensure the project's success. - **HR Tech Support Specialist**: HR Tech Support Specialists assist organizations with technical issues related to HR software and tools. They troubleshoot problems, provide training, and ensure a smooth user experience. - **HR Tech Sales Representative**: HR Tech Sales Representatives promote HR technology products and services to potential clients. They demonstrate product features, negotiate contracts, and build long-term relationships with customers. - **HR Tech Trainer**: HR Tech Trainers help organizations maximize their investment in HR technology by conducting training sessions and workshops. They ensure that employees understand the features, benefits, and best practices of HR technology tools.
